SPECS: util-vserver.spec - fix lib/lib64 problem in initscripts
baggins
baggins at pld-linux.org
Thu Jun 30 19:04:01 CEST 2005
Author: baggins Date: Thu Jun 30 17:04:01 2005 GMT
Module: SPECS Tag: HEAD
---- Log message:
- fix lib/lib64 problem in initscripts
---- Files affected:
SPECS:
util-vserver.spec (1.55 -> 1.56)
---- Diffs:
================================================================
Index: SPECS/util-vserver.spec
diff -u SPECS/util-vserver.spec:1.55 SPECS/util-vserver.spec:1.56
--- SPECS/util-vserver.spec:1.55 Thu Jun 30 17:43:50 2005
+++ SPECS/util-vserver.spec Thu Jun 30 19:03:55 2005
@@ -9,7 +9,7 @@
Summary(pl): Narzędzia dla linuksowych serwerów wirtualnych
Name: util-vserver
Version: 0.30.207
-Release: 5.2
+Release: 5.3
License: GPL
Group: Applications/System
Source0: http://www.13thfloor.at/~ensc/util-vserver/files/alpha/%{name}-%{version}.tar.bz2
@@ -35,6 +35,7 @@
%{?with_dietlibc:BuildRequires: dietlibc-static >= 2:0.29}
BuildRequires: libstdc++-devel
BuildRequires: libtool >= 1.5.14
+BuildREquires: sed
%if %{with doc}
BuildRequires: doxygen
BuildRequires: graphviz
@@ -300,10 +301,15 @@
EOF
done
-install %{SOURCE1} $RPM_BUILD_ROOT/etc/rc.d/init.d/vprocunhide
-install %{SOURCE2} $RPM_BUILD_ROOT/etc/rc.d/init.d/vservers-default
-install %{SOURCE3} $RPM_BUILD_ROOT/etc/rc.d/init.d/vservers-legacy
-install %{SOURCE4} $RPM_BUILD_ROOT/etc/rc.d/init.d/rebootmgr
+sed 's|/usr/lib/util-vserver|%{_libdir}/%{name}|g' %{SOURCE1} > \
+ $RPM_BUILD_ROOT/etc/rc.d/init.d/vprocunhide
+sed 's|/usr/lib/util-vserver|%{_libdir}/%{name}|g' %{SOURCE2} > \
+ $RPM_BUILD_ROOT/etc/rc.d/init.d/vservers-default
+sed 's|/usr/lib/util-vserver|%{_libdir}/%{name}|g' %{SOURCE3} > \
+ $RPM_BUILD_ROOT/etc/rc.d/init.d/vservers-legacy
+sed 's|/usr/lib/util-vserver|%{_libdir}/%{name}|g' %{SOURCE4} > \
+ $RPM_BUILD_ROOT/etc/rc.d/init.d/rebootmgr
+
install %{SOURCE5} $RPM_BUILD_ROOT/etc/sysconfig/vservers-default
install %{SOURCE6} $RPM_BUILD_ROOT/etc/sysconfig/vservers-legacy
@@ -538,6 +544,9 @@
All persons listed below can be reached at <cvs_login>@pld-linux.org
$Log$
+Revision 1.56 2005/06/30 17:03:55 baggins
+- fix lib/lib64 problem in initscripts
+
Revision 1.55 2005/06/30 15:43:50 baggins
- merged core with main package (it was unneedded entity)
- cleaned up duplicate %%files
================================================================
---- CVS-web:
http://cvs.pld-linux.org/SPECS/util-vserver.spec?r1=1.55&r2=1.56&f=u
More information about the pld-cvs-commit
mailing list